This CD presents the basic
principles and techniques of cryptanalysts and their relation to
cryptography. Cryptography concerns the various ways of protecting messages
from being understood by anyone except those for whom the messages are intended.
Cryptographers are the people who create and use codes and ciphers.
Cryptanalytics is the art and science of solving unknown codes and ciphers.
Cryptanalysts try to break the codes and ciphers created and used by
cryptographers.
This Cryptography Course Training Manual is organized
into six parts. Part One explains basic principles which apply to all the
parts that follow. The following five parts each cover a major type of system
and the cryptanalytic techniques that apply to it. Parts Two, Three, and Four
each build on the techniques explained in the parts that precede them. A new
student should study these in order. Parts Five and Six are largely independent
of Parts Two through Four and can be used separately after Part One.
